Design, engineering, procurement, and construction of chain link fencing around the solar park boundary
Design, engineering, procurement, and construction of chain link fencing around the solar park boundary, including excavation, supply and installation of RCC or MS angle posts (minimum size 50x50x5 mm) of total height 2.2 meters above finished ground level, spaced at intervals not exceeding 3.0 meters, along with all required intermediate, corner (with double stays), and transverse stay posts (every tenth post), as per drawings. Fencing shall consist of PVC-coated GI chain link mesh (minimum 4.0 mm overall diameter with 2.5 mm GI core wire), mesh size 50x50 mm, fixed to a height of 1.8 meters above toe wall, securely tied and tensioned with three strands of 4.0 mm dia high tensile spring steel wire (HTSSW), and further supported with clamping strips on every fourth post using galvanized security bolts. Four lines of GI barbed wire (12x14 gauge) shall be provided above the chain link mesh to achieve a total fencing height of 2.2 meters. All structural steel components, including posts, stays, clamps, wires, bolts, and fasteners, shall be hot-dip galvanized with minimum 90-micron zinc coating (equivalent to 610 gsm) or epoxy-coated to comply with ISO 12944 for C4 corrosion category. A toe wall of suitable masonry with coping and weep holes shall be provided below the fence mesh as per tender drawings. The item also includes supply of all materials, tools, transport, site preparation, foundation in M20 concrete, erection, alignment, tensioning, testing, commissioning, and all required workmanship to complete the fencing in all respects as per specifications, drawings, and directions of the Engineer-in-Charge.

Design, engineering, procurement, and construction of complete drinking water supply system
Design, engineering, procurement, and construction of complete drinking water supply system at the control room building in the South Block of the RE park, including development of a deep borewell (minimum 150–200 meters deep, depending on hydrogeological conditions), casing with MS/GI/HDPE pipe, submersible pump (minimum 1.5 HP, stainless steel, suitable for high-TDS >40,000 ppm), electrical control panel, cabling, and associated civil works. The raw water shall be treated using a customized high-salinity Reverse Osmosis (RO) plant (minimum 100 LPH capacity), comprising multi-stage pretreatment units including sediment filtration, activated carbon filtration, antiscalant dosing system, high-pressure multistage pumps (SS construction), high-recovery RO membranes suitable for brackish/saline water (>40,000 ppm TDS), and automatic flushing system. Additional post-treatment may include UV sterilization and remineralization unit (to improve potability). The plant shall be designed for 10–12 hours/day operation to cater to approx. 20 personnel and shall include a water storage and distribution system with a minimum of 1000-litre triple-layer HDPE overhead tank, CPVC/GI piping network for raw and treated water, and at least one stainless steel water cooler with integrated purifier (minimum 120 L cooling capacity, dual tap). All components shall be suitable for C4 corrosion category environment (Khavda region), and energy-efficient. The scope includes structural foundation for equipment, mounting platforms, RO plant housing (PUF-panel room or FRP enclosure), earthing, plumbing, and internal distribution. The work includes testing, commissioning, water quality testing, and handing over of a fully functional system with O&M manual and basic spares.
